VM2382CF

8-OUT, 1TP Output Card for V-Matrix

The 

VM2382CF

is an 8 Twisted Pair Output card 

designed for use with all ALTINEX standards for 
Twisted Pair signal transmission including TP 
receivers like the DA1931CT and MT103-123.  The 
Twisted Pair signals from the 

VM2382CF

may be 

easily distributed to the single channel inputs of a 
receiver using ALTINEX cables such as the 
MS8704TP.The 

VM2382CF

Output card works with 

its counterpart, the VM2831CF Input Card. 

See the

VM2381CF for more information.

Each 

VM2382CF

can  transmit  2 4TP ALTINEX 

Standard signals for a maximum of 32 4TP outputs 
per enclosure. The input and output cards both 
provide excellent bandwidth allowing them to pass 
high-resolution computer video + audio signals 
without signal degradation.

The 

VM2382CF

is hot-swappable with finger 

adjustable lock-down screws and positive 
engagement card-edge connections.

The latest generation of Twisted Pair devices uses 
an innovative, patented technology* developed by 
ALTINEX. The new signal processing technology 
allows transmitting and receiving fully equalized 
computer video signals, stereo, and audio signals 
over long distances. The maximum distance at full 
UXGA resolution is 400 ft (122 m) between devices 
and may reach up to 750 ft (230 m) at VGA 
resolution.
